Car Organizational Hacks for Roadtrippers

Use a Seat-Back Organizer 

One of the best things we brought for the trip was a seat-back organizer. It was a lifesaver for keeping snacks, water bottles, sunscreen, and even extra masks within reach. Instead of having things scattered around, everything had a designated pocket. This is a must-have whether you’re renting a car for travel or just trying to keep your daily drive with kids more manageable.

Pack Storage Bins for the Trunk

A well-organized trunk made unpacking and repacking effortless. We used foldable storage bins to separate essential items—one for snacks and water, another for spare clothes and shoes, and a dedicated bin for travel must-haves like a first-aid kit and extra wipes. Having everything categorized meant we weren’t digging through luggage every time we needed something. When we used the service of car hire Dubai, this kept us from worrying about the risk leaving behind personal belongings when changing cars.

Keep Essentials in a Glove Box Organizer 

We quickly learned that a messy glove compartment is the last thing you want when you need something urgently. Using a simple glove box organizer helped us store important documents like our rental agreement, insurance papers, emergency contacts, and even a few local travel guides. Whether you’re renting a car or driving your own, keeping these items neatly stored can save you from unnecessary stress.

Use a Car Trash Bin 

Long drives mean lots of snack wrappers, receipts, and other small waste. A compact, leak-proof trash bin was an easy solution that kept the car clean and odor-free. We lined it with small disposable bags, so we could empty it effortlessly at rest stops. If you’re traveling with kids, this is a must to avoid accumulating clutter on the road.

Use Silicone Cup Holder Liners 

Cup holders tend to collect spills, crumbs, and dust. Silicone cup holder liners were a simple addition that made cleaning so much easier—just pop them out, rinse, and put them back. This was especially useful during our UAE trip when we were constantly sipping water to stay hydrated in the heat.

Install a Headrest Hook for Bags 

Shopping in Dubai was fun, but we quickly realized that loose bags rolling around the backseat were not. Headrest hooks became our go-to for securing grocery bags, purses, and even small backpacks. It’s a small change that makes a big difference in keeping the car neat and preventing spills.

What To Keep Close When Going On A Long Drive?

Pack a Small Emergency Kit 

Safety should always be your number one priority while driving in the UAE. Keep a compact emergency kit with you that contains the following: a basic first aid kit, a flashlight, jumper cables, and a tire repair kit. It will save you during situations such as flat tires or minor injuries. It is always a good idea to take extra water, a basic toolset, and a portable charger if you are going into the desert. Simple add-ons like a car inspection mirror can also be useful for quickly checking underneath your vehicle if you suspect damage or obstacles. Taking precautions helps you stay calm and ensures a safe journey.

Keep a Portable Car Vacuum 

Sand and dust can collect very fast in a car, especially in the dry climate of the UAE. A handheld vacuum will make cleaning seats and floors very easy to maintain your car’s freshness. Regular vacuuming will also minimize allergens and dirt buildup.

Organize Charging Cables 

With multiple devices in use, tangled charging cables can become a hassle. Use labeled Velcro straps or cable organizers to keep them neat and easy to find. This simple trick saves time and prevents frustration when looking for the right charger. Setting up a dedicated charging station in your car makes it even more convenient.

Keep a Family Travel Essentials Kit in the Car

One of the best organization tips we learned was to pack a small bag with must-haves like wet wipes, tissues, hand sanitizer, extra masks, small toys, and healthy snacks. This emergency kit saved us multiple times—whether it was cleaning up after an unexpected spill or keeping the kids entertained during long drives.

These simple car organization hacks made our first trip to the UAE much easier, and have been a part of our routine. Whether you’re renting a car on vacation or managing daily commutes with your family, staying organized makes every drive smoother, safer, and stress-free.
